FARMERS BANK AND SAVINGS COMPANY, THE is an FDIC-insured commercial bank headquartered in POMEROY, OH, established in 1904. As of , the bank reported total assets of $463M and total deposits of $419M. Profitability stands at 0.78% ROA and 8.49% ROE, with a net interest margin of 3.79%. CET1 capital ratio: 8.58%. NPL ratio: 0.89% · Texas Ratio: 6.26%. Operates 9 domestic branches.

Automated conditions triggered on this bank's latest filing. Advisory only — see the source metric pages for full context.

Uninsured deposits at 75.4% of total — SVB-style run-risk profileWhat does this mean? →

Over 70% of deposits sit above the $250K FDIC insurance threshold. This is the depositor-concentration profile that triggered Silicon Valley Bank's March 2023 deposit run.

Quarterly trend — last 8 quarters

Quarter-over-quarter movement in the five most-watched ratios. Sourced from the bank's own FFIEC call report filings.

QuarterCET1ROANPLTexasNIM
2025-12-318.58%0.78%0.89%6.26%3.79%
2025-09-308.41%0.72%2.00%14.19%3.69%
2025-06-308.04%0.75%2.15%15.32%3.61%
2025-03-317.80%0.54%2.33%16.31%3.26%
2024-12-317.45%0.46%2.19%16.53%3.22%
2024-09-308.03%0.49%2.42%17.37%3.12%
2024-06-307.36%0.57%1.42%10.94%3.09%
2024-03-317.26%0.42%2.07%15.70%2.93%
